Computação Múltipla Escolha

A proposta da orientação a objetos é deslocar o esforço de desenvolvimento para a fase de análise, dando ênfase às estruturas de dados antes das funções. Isso proporciona uma abordagem mais estruturada, favorecendo a organização e qualidade do software. Com base no texto apresentado e nos fundamentos da orientação a objetos, analise as afirmativas a seguir: Reutilização do código (componentes). II. Confiabilidade (objetos encapsulados). III. Redução da análise do sistema. IV. Aumento de produtividade.

A proposta da orientação a objetos é deslocar o esforço de desenvolvimento para a fase de análise, dando ênfase às estruturas de dados antes das funções. Isso proporciona uma abordagem mais estruturada, favorecendo a organização e qualidade do software.

Com base no texto apresentado e nos fundamentos da orientação a objetos, analise as afirmativas a seguir:

I. Reutilização do código (componentes).
II. Confiabilidade (objetos encapsulados).
III. Redução da análise do sistema.
IV. Aumento de produtividade.

  1. I e II, apenas.
  2. I e III, apenas.
  3. I, II e III, apenas.
  4. I, II e IV, apenas.
  5. I, II, III e IV.

Resolução completa

Explicação passo a passo

Resumo da resposta

Alternativa 4 - I, II e IV, apenas

⚠️ PEGADINHA: 'Redução' ≠ 'Ênfase' na Análise!

A questão tenta confundir o candidato sobre o papel da análise no paradigma Orientação a Objetos (POO).

Fundamentos da Orientação a Objetos

BenefícioExplicação
ReutilizaçãoClasses e herança permitem reaproveitar código existente
ConfiabilidadeEncapsulamento protege dados internos dos objetos
ProdutividadeManutenção mais fácil acelera desenvolvimento
AnáliseÊNFASE maior, NÃO redução

Análise das Afirmativas

  • I. REUTILIZAÇÃO DO CÓDIGO ✅ CORRETA
  • Um dos pilares da POO é reutilizar componentes através de herança e composição
  • II. CONFIABILIDADE ✅ CORRETA
  • O encapsulamento protege o estado interno dos objetos, aumentando confiabilidade
  • III. REDUÇÃO DA ANÁLISE ❌ ERRADA
  • O texto diz explicitamente: "deslocar o esforço para a fase de análise"
  • Isso significa MAIS ênfase, não redução
  • Pegadinha comum: trocar "ênfase" por "redução"
  • IV. AUMENTO DE PRODUTIVIDADE ✅ CORRETA
  • Software orientado a objetos facilita manutenção e evolução
  • Resulta em maior produtividade no ciclo de desenvolvimento

Resumo Comparativo

Texto OriginalAfirmação IIIConclusão
"Deslocar para análise""Redução da análise"❌ Contraditório

Conclusão

Apenas as afirmativas I, II e IV estão corretas. A afirmativa III contradiz diretamente o enunciado, que afirma que a POO dá maior ênfase à fase de análise, não reduzindo-a.

Resposta final: Alternativa 4

Tem outra questão para resolver?

Resolver agora com IA

Mais questões de Computação

Ver mais Computação resolvidas

Tem outra questão de Computação?

Cole o enunciado, tire uma foto ou descreva o problema — a IA resolve com explicação completa em segundos.